In contrast to larger scooters, which can be heavy and difficult to maneuver, the Go-Go Elite Traveller is a compact mobility aid that is easy to maneuver and can be disassembled into four light pieces. Its heaviest piece weighs just 28 pounds, and the entire unit can fit in the trunk of a vehicle, SUV or a standard-sized sedan. It's also lightweight and compact enough to fit into most public transportation vehicles, including buses and taxis. The adjustable seat, tiller handle that reduces arm and wrist strain as well as the large storage basket make it the perfect option for long commutes or trips to the grocery store. Its compact size and light design allow it to be fully charged and ready to go. You can request one to be delivered to a ship, hotel, or airport for a cruise or vacation. Glashow Mobility Scooter – S3 The Glashow Mobility Scooter S3 has an impressive range of up to 25 miles on one charge. Its high-powered motor and big wheels (9” front & 10” rear) allow it to easily traverse a variety of roads and smoothly cross curbs that are up to 2.76 inches tall. The scooter is also equipped with a simple two-step folding mechanism that makes it easy to place in your trunk or car boot. Glashow is comprised of pragmatists who are dedicated to using technology in a way that improves people's lives. They have worked within the consumer tech sector and have discovered a need for more efficient, more convenient travel mobility solutions. The information they gathered from their research is utilized to create innovative scooters which are easier to use than ever before. They have integrated advanced technologies from other fields, for instance sensors on seats that are typically used to monitor car seats. This lets the scooter only operate when the user is seated properly, preventing accidents that could result from an uncontrolled acceleration. They also have added IMU sensors that are commonly employed in drone technology to precisely determining acceleration at the turn and slope grade. They even went so far as to add the brake lock usually found on industrial robotic arms to make their scooters more secure and more secure. The company's engineers have also created a brushless motor that has high efficiency that reduces vibration and noise. The scooters are lightweight, which allows them to maneuver effortlessly through elevators and doors.
